![]() ![]() You need to do is wrap the Dialog in a, and dialog will transition automaticallyÄ«ased on the state of the show prop on the. To animate the opening/closing of the dialog, use the Transition component. So, when using our Dialog, there's no need to use a Portal yourself! Learn how to group multiple elements in React using Fragment, Short Syntax. The parent component must take the dimensions of child component, so adjusts' its height and width. When using a context, the subscription to the width/height in your React component should look similar to this one. ![]() Use React. The rendered component is here the child component which using react-sizeme to get its size and pass back to parent component. What React version used If you used React(over 16.8), I recommend solution I used. This way we can provide features like unobstructed event handling and making the A parent component receives the component to be rendered (popped up). ![]() Ive built this code to get the width of the element, but right now it doesnt work for the first render. When dealing with UI elements in React.js sometimes we find ourselves conditionally rendering some JSX elements based on the size of the viewports window. Makes it easy to apply scroll locking to the rest of your application, as well as ensure that yourÄialog's contents and backdrop are unobstructed to receive focus and click events.Ä«ecause of these accessibility concerns, Headless UI's Dialog component actually uses a Portal Hence, the width of ResultList is responsive and it varies. Introduction React is well-known for thinking in terms of components, which means breaking complex UI components down into smaller ones. Ordering to ensure that their content is rendered on top of your existing application UI. Sibling to the root-most node of your React application. React Fragment is a component exposed by React which serves as a parent component in JSX but doesnât add anything to the DOM.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|